392HEMI POA Site Supporter Prowler Junkie From:The Villages, Fl. |
posted 06-01-2007 12:19 PM
Heck with the hood cat, that is a frame jig that is sitting in. NOT good, as aluminum doesn't like to unbend in the exact locations of the original bends. What a "bear" to align again. No punn intended. lol |
